What CL2.091.01 means

Inducer Comm Error — loss of communication between the furnace control board and the draft-inducer motor control board.

Likely causes, most common first

  1. Faulty connection or harness between the furnace control board and the inducer motor control board
  2. Faulty inducer drive board
